'conservative correctness' vs. 'political correctness'
http://www.liberaloasis.com/

I found this interesting, even that he speaks well of Michelle Malkin.

Particularly the conclusion:

"In any event, "Conservative Correctness" should be called out for what it is. Mischief making.

For whatever excesses have occurred under the umbrella of "P.C.," at least the intentions were generally honorable -- mainly, trying to rid society of debilitating bigotry.

"Conservative Correctness" is not well intentioned. It's simply just about intimidating people who disagree with you.

And it will not end with this episode.

John Edwards should not think he can stave it off by whacking his bloggers. Other candidates should not think they can avoid it by watching their words and vetting their staffs.

Because C.C. is not guided by principle. It does not wait for an actual transgression. It is happy to selectively quote, distort and manufacture outrage."

I am not sure if ignoring it is an effective strategy. I think what needs to be done is call the practioners on their selective quotations, distortions and manufactured outrage so that they lose credibility in the eyes of most people.
